What are UV protection tops?
- UV protection tops are specially designed garments that help shield your skin from harmful ultraviolet (UV) rays. They are made from fabrics that have been treated or constructed to provide a higher level of UV protection compared to regular clothing. These tops are ideal for outdoor activities where sun exposure is a concern.
How do UV protection tops work?
- UV protection tops work by using fabrics that either absorb or reflect UV radiation, reducing the amount that reaches your skin. The effectiveness of these tops is often measured by a UPF (Ultraviolet Protection Factor) rating, which indicates how much UV radiation can penetrate the fabric. Higher UPF ratings provide better protection.

Can I wear UV protection tops in the water?
- Many UV protection tops are designed to be water-resistant or quick-drying, making them suitable for water activities such as swimming or kayaking. However, it's important to check the product details to ensure they are specifically made for aquatic environments, as not all UV tops are intended for use in water.
Do UV protection tops replace sunscreen?
- While UV protection tops provide an additional layer of defence against UV rays, they should not replace sunscreen. It is still recommended to apply broad-spectrum sunscreen on exposed skin for comprehensive protection, especially during prolonged sun exposure. Combining both methods offers the best defence against sun damage.
